Lagos-based HMO listed on the NHIA accredited-HMO register (ID 74), with retail, corporate (Health Shield), geriatric and diaspora plans and a stated presence across Nigeria's 36 states.

Pros
  • Verified on the NHIA accredited-HMO register (ID 74)
  • Unusually broad plan menu, including geriatric and diaspora-funded plans that many HMOs do not offer
  • Mobile app (Novo Companion) and enrollee portal for managing cover
Cons
  • Publishes no provider-network size, so network depth is hard to compare before you enrol
  • NHIA accreditation is not displayed on its own website — you have to check the regulator's register yourself
  • Smaller brand than the tier-one HMOs, with less independent coverage of its claims record
Fees, eligibility & documents
Fees
PremiumQualitative — request a quote. Novo advertises retail plans starting from ₦72,292.50/yr (provider's own figure); corporate pricing is negotiated per group.
Eligibility
  • Individuals, families and employer groups in Nigeria
  • Diaspora plans allow Nigerians abroad to buy cover for relatives at home
  • Geriatric plan targets older enrollees, an age band many HMOs exclude
Documents needed
  • Completed enrolment form
  • Contact and identification details for each enrollee
  • Premium payment (annual for retail plans)
